TASK 4: Assessment

Directions: Using 1 paragraph, discuss the following topics.

1. Soul Making in art- making and extracting meanings from art. In art, in order for people
to make sense of the work, it will require an understanding of the visual elements on
which art is based, especially the principles of design.

2. Appropriation:

a. ObjectAppropriation-
occurs when the existence of a tangible work of art such as sculptures and
paintings are transferred from members of one culture to members of another
culture.

b. Content- the writer who retells stories made by a culture other than his
own. A musician who sings songs of another culture is engaged in
providing the content.

c. Style- refers to the composing of technique from others. Borrowing,


acquiring, or adapting a style.

d.Motif- this form is associated with stylistic appropriation.Sometimes artists are


influenced by the art of a culture other than their own without producing works in
the same style.

It's the one that takes ideas and doesn’t copy the content, just takes a little bit of
art style ideas.
e. Subject- This is taking the subject into a culture. Example of this is to
getting a subject in a community to present to their film production.
